    Sense Than Episode #3 I talk with John Walsh who served with me during OEF. We were deployed to Logar Province Afghanistan for several months. I try to catch up with him in his current life.   Everyone has many thoughts and feelings on Afghanistan, I talk with Walsh who has seen what Afghanistan has to offer the Soldiers that go there. No topic is untouched as we dive back into the past one last time to discuss the current and previous events there.  Life can be hard for all but harder for some. John gave his all for his fellow Soldiers and left a piece of himself in the process. Yet he still chose to fight hard to survive in the harshest of conditions to ensure he was there. I truly appreciate all the knowledge he had passed to me through the years. I hope he can shed some light on your life like he has mine.

    Episode #2 of the Sense Than podcast is focused on my old friend London. We served together for many years and had always had great conversations, so naturally, he is here to share his experiences on the Military deployments, L.E.O and Firefighting. He has a multitude of skills and is one of the most professional individuals I know. I hope you enjoy this content.
